Output 34a09d5dfd14e6de00b5ae354854c7dbf99d1acaf8e583b746aa9f3f7411dfe9:28

value
1767331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c51f019926468c14aa0cfecccdad245bba5b0c OP_EQUAL
address
3Q1EwZmXBRDZvLPV63EKoJbNCVWxn6tgsP
transaction
34a09d5dfd14e6de00b5ae354854c7dbf99d1acaf8e583b746aa9f3f7411dfe9
confirmations
190857
spent
true